This exciting opportunity offers a qualified and interested candidate a key contributor role that combines analytics and data governance skills .
The candidate will work with Global Privacy and Privacy Portal Technology Teams to strengthen privacy reporting and Privacy Portal Management tool governance, as well as document and manage program metrics, data transformation activities, and business requirements .
The role includes enhancing existing reporting and data management components to align with the future-state strategy and governance model while coordinating with other data analytics functions .
The position focuses on building processes, documentation, and reporting structures that support privacy program maturity and provide defensible, reliable insights for decision-making.
What you will do: C reating a privacy reporting function that enables measurable privacy compliance and performance .
With that privacy layer, the reports become support of the Global Privacy Program's governance and accountability.
The role requires both technical data analytics skills as well as documentation and organization of the following key areas of focus: Power BI Dashboard Management Data Transformation: Power BI reporting inventories, sources, design, and data validations, and data transformations.
Metrics Reporting : Metric inventories and calculations, r eporting design and preparation, development of reporting narrative, data patterns, and insights.
Reporting Data Governance : Business requirements, process flow, issue and exception management, roles and responsibilities, and SOPs related to privacy reporting .
Privacy Portal Management Support : Supporting the build out of business requirements, training, and documentation related to the global privacy OneTrust platform .
Serv e as the liaison with business technology and monitor technology en hancement s /initiatives.
